隨著信息技術(shù)的飛速發(fā)展,教育領(lǐng)域?qū)Ω咝Ч芾戆嗉壥聞?wù)的需求日益增長。Java作為一種成熟、穩(wěn)定且跨平臺的編程語言,成為開發(fā)班級事務(wù)管理系統(tǒng)的理想選擇。本系統(tǒng)旨在為學(xué)校班級提供一個全面、便捷的事務(wù)管理解決方案,涵蓋學(xué)生信息管理、課程安排、考勤記錄、通知發(fā)布、活動組織等核心功能,通過計算機系統(tǒng)服務(wù)提升班級管理的效率與透明度。
在系統(tǒng)設(shè)計階段,我們采用了面向?qū)ο蟮脑O(shè)計思想,結(jié)合MVC(Model-View-Controller)架構(gòu)模式,確保代碼的可維護(hù)性和可擴展性。后端使用Java語言,結(jié)合Spring Boot框架快速搭建服務(wù),數(shù)據(jù)庫采用MySQL存儲學(xué)生、教師、課程和事務(wù)數(shù)據(jù)。前端則使用HTML、CSS和JavaScript,輔以Bootstrap框架實現(xiàn)響應(yīng)式界面,確保用戶在不同設(shè)備上都能獲得良好的體驗。系統(tǒng)服務(wù)層通過RESTful API提供數(shù)據(jù)交互,支持多角色登錄(如班主任、學(xué)生、班干部),并根據(jù)權(quán)限動態(tài)展示功能模塊。
系統(tǒng)核心功能包括:學(xué)生信息模塊,支持添加、修改、查詢和刪除學(xué)生檔案;考勤管理模塊,允許教師記錄每日出勤情況并生成統(tǒng)計報表;通知公告模塊,實現(xiàn)班級通知的發(fā)布、編輯和推送;課程安排模塊,幫助班級規(guī)劃每周課程表;活動管理模塊,便于組織班級活動并跟蹤參與情況。系統(tǒng)還集成了數(shù)據(jù)備份和日志記錄服務(wù),確保數(shù)據(jù)安全與操作可追溯。
在實現(xiàn)過程中,我們注重用戶體驗和系統(tǒng)性能。通過單元測試和集成測試,驗證了功能的正確性,并利用緩存技術(shù)優(yōu)化數(shù)據(jù)查詢速度。該系統(tǒng)不僅簡化了班級日常事務(wù)的處理,還促進(jìn)了師生之間的信息共享,為計算機系統(tǒng)服務(wù)在教育管理中的應(yīng)用提供了實用案例。可擴展人工智能模塊,如自動考勤分析或智能通知推薦,以進(jìn)一步提升系統(tǒng)的智能化水平。
如若轉(zhuǎn)載,請注明出處:http://www.xiebaofa.com.cn/product/18.html
更新時間:2026-01-23 21:54:23